Chilis Cajun Chicken Pasta

Chilis Cajun Chicken Pasta That's Better Than the Restaurant

This Chilis Cajun Chicken Pasta is a quick, one-pan meal full of bold flavors and creamy comfort, perfect for busy weeknights.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Cajun-American
Calories: 600

Ingredients
  

For the Chicken
  • 2 pieces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ts Pound to ¾-inch thickness for even cooking.
  • 1 tablespoon Olive Oil Can substitute with canola oil if needed.
For the Pasta
  • 8 ounces Penne Pasta You can swap with your favorite pasta type.
For the Sauce
  • 1 cup Heavy Cream A lighter option can be used, but it might alter the final texture.
  • 1 cup Chicken Broth Vegetable broth can be used for a vegetarian-friendly version.
  • ½ cup Freshly Grated Parmesan Cheese Fresh cheese melts better than pre-shredded varieties.
  • 3 cloves Garlic Freshly minced for optimal flavor infusion.
  • 1 teaspoon Salt Adjust according to your taste preferences.
For the Cajun Spice Blend
  • 1 teaspoon Paprika Delivers color and a smoky flavor.
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der Boosts the garlic flavor.
  • 1 teaspoon Onion Powder Adds a touch of sweetness and depth.
  • 1 teaspoon Oregano A must for herbal complexity.
  • 1 teaspoon Thyme Feel free to adjust based on your own herb garden!
  • ½ teaspoon Black Pepper Adjust the quantities based on your spice tolerance.
  • ½ teaspoon Cayenne Pepper Adjust the quantities based on your spice tolerance.
  • ½ teaspoon White Pepper Adjust the quantities based on your spice tolerance.

Equipment

  • large skillet
  • Pot
  • mixing bowl

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Chilis Cajun Chicken Pasta
  1. In a small bowl, combine pa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, oregano, thyme, black pepper, cayenne pepper, and white pepper. Mix well to create a Cajun spice blend.
  2.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add half of the Cajun spice mixture and s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ant. Add the chicken, seasoning with the remaining spice blend. Cook for 5-7 minutes on each side until golden brown, then remove from skillet.
  3. In the same skillet, bring a pot of salted water to a boil. Add penne pasta and cook until al dente, about 10-12 minutes. Drain and reserve the skillet.
  4. With the skillet still on low heat, add minced garlic and sauté for 30 seconds. Pour in heavy cream and chicken broth, stirring to combine. Let simmer for 3-4 minutes until thickened.
  5. Stir in freshly grated Parmesan cheese until melted and evenly combined. Return chicken to the skillet, coating it with the sauce.
  6. Gently fold the drained penne pasta into the chicken and sauce mixture. Heat through for 1-2 minutes on low. Plate warm and enjoy.

Notes

Bloom the Cajun spice mix in hot oil for a richer taste. Ensure chicken is pounded to ¾-inch thickness for even cooking.
